RICHARDSON, Texas - It was a tough night for the Belhaven University men's basketball team on Thursday evening as they fell 103-54 at UT Dallas in American Southwest Conference play.

HOW IT HAPPENED
- UT Dallas shot 62 percent from the field throughout the contest on timely buckets all across the perimeter.
- Early on, Belhaven maintained its composure and hung in with the Comets by trading baskets.
- Isiah Brown knocked down a three midway through the first half to pace the Blazers' offense.
- UTD lead by only one possession at 23-20 with 6:22 to play before halftime.
- However, the Comets would go on a tear to end the half, which lead to a 22-8 run and a double digit lead at 45-28.
- Turnovers hurt the Blazers' in the second half, as UT Dallas would only continue to extend their advantage out.
- The Comets started the second half on a 17-3Â run and never looked back as they pushed the lead up to 62-31.
- UT Dallas forced 16 steals on the evening and wound up leading by as much as 49 by the end of the contest.

KEY STATISTICS
- Jonathan Durham, Rick Hodum, Justin Jones, and Joshua Roberts each scored eight points apiece to lead the Blazers in the scoring column.
- Isiah Brown chipped in with seven points, while John Works notched six points.
- Belhaven was limited to just 33 percent shooting from the floor.
- The Green and Gold connected on nine three-point field goals.
- Hodum and David Cole combined for five rebounds apiece.
- The Blazers committed 27 turnovers on the night and were also out-rebounded 36-25.
- The Comets scored 36 points off of turnovers and accumulated 44 points inside the paint.
